Contact Dermatitis
Contact dermatitis is a typical sort of allergic response to nail polish, characterised by irritation of the pores and skin. It usually happens inside hours or days of publicity and includes localized pores and skin reactions. This response is commonly the preliminary manifestation of a nail polish allergy. Contact dermatitis is mostly not life-threatening, however may cause vital discomfort and intrude with each day actions.
Urticaria (Hives)
Urticaria, generally generally known as hives, is one other allergic response to nail polish. It includes the event of itchy, raised welts on the pores and skin. These welts can fluctuate in dimension and form, and sometimes seem in clusters. Urticaria can happen inside minutes to hours after publicity. Whereas usually resolving spontaneously, persistent or extreme circumstances could require medical intervention.
Anaphylaxis
Anaphylaxis is a extreme, life-threatening allergic response. It includes a fast and systemic response of the physique’s immune system to an allergen, like nail polish. Signs can embrace swelling of the face, lips, and throat, problem respiration, dizziness, and lack of consciousness. Anaphylaxis requires speedy medical consideration, together with the administration of epinephrine. Immediate remedy is essential to forestall probably deadly outcomes.
Circumstances of anaphylaxis because of nail polish are uncommon, however pose a major danger if not managed promptly.

Kinds of Allergy Checks
Completely different allergy checks assess completely different elements of the immune system’s response. Pores and skin prick checks contain putting a small quantity of suspected allergen on the pores and skin and observing for a response. Whereas helpful for sure allergens, they’re much less dependable for figuring out contact dermatitis. Blood checks, comparable to IgE antibody checks, can measure the presence of antibodies associated to allergic reactions however should not usually the first-line diagnostic strategy for nail polish allergic reactions.
Patch testing, then again, instantly assesses the pores and skin’s response to potential allergens.
Patch Check Process
A patch take a look at includes making use of small quantities of suspected allergens to the pores and skin, normally on the higher again. The process usually follows these steps:
- Preparation: The pores and skin on the again is fastidiously cleansed and marked with small circles to place the take a look at allergens. The person is educated on avoiding potential irritants and performing skincare that will not intrude with the take a look at outcomes. The clinician ensures the affected person understands that the take a look at will not be meant for speedy aid, and any signs that will seem throughout the take a look at are anticipated to fade away inside just a few days.
- Utility: Small quantities of various nail polish elements are positioned onto small discs (patches) which are then utilized to the pores and skin. These patches are secured with tape and stay in place for 48 hours. Following this preliminary publicity, a second evaluation is carried out after one other 48 hours.
- Observe-up: The person returns to the clinic for the patches to be eliminated. The pores and skin is examined for any indicators of reactions, comparable to redness, swelling, or blistering. The severity of the response is documented, and the outcomes are correlated with the particular allergens to find out the causative agent.

Limitations of Patch Testing
Whereas patch testing is a priceless diagnostic instrument, it does have limitations. False unfavorable outcomes can happen if the focus of the allergen is just too low, or if the allergen will not be included within the take a look at panel. Moreover, the take a look at could not precisely replicate the person’s response to a selected product containing a number of substances. Moreover, the take a look at could be affected by particular person pores and skin sensitivities, and a response could not at all times be in keeping with the allergen’s focus.
